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1447496282 85 19969 85 30951304185
914889 861046 6796592
914889 861046 6796592
4187908289 56 00 907874 28394458
All about undefined
Interested in learning more?
914889 861046 6796592
4187908289 56 00 907874 28394458
See more
647841 471834
3457792371 083 846619596
See more
4855730 0438 76
6162581989 787 933430 38
See more